Veena: Meaning, Sanskrit Origin, and Cultural Significance

What Does Veena Mean?

The name Veena (वीणा) is a direct Sanskrit word referring to the traditional Indian stringed instrument (lute). It is the primary symbol of music, wisdom, and the arts.

Veena symbolizes harmony, creative expression, and the vibration of the universe. As a name, it describes a person who is aesthetically refined, expressive, and possesses a natural "receptivity"—someone whose life is a practice of balance and beauty.

Origin and Cultural Significance

Veena is one of the most spiritually and culturally prestigious names for girls in India. It is the instrument held by Goddess Saraswati, the deity of knowledge and music, representing the voice of the soul. The name reflects a cultural value placed on education and the importance of having a refined and intuitive character. It has remained a favorite across India for generations, representing a cultural ideal of intellectual grace combined with creative vitality.

Veena in Indian Tradition

In the musical tradition, the Veena is considered the most sacred instrument, said to be an extension of the goddess herself. The name carries an association with "purity" and "spiritual clarity." It is a "Sattvic" name, evoking images of temple hymns, quiet study, and the quiet satisfaction of a life lived in harmony with the truth.
